Trichinellosis, also called trichinosis, is caused by eating raw or undercooked meat of animals infected with the larvae of a species of worm called … WebJun 27, 2024 · Trichinellosis (trichinosis) is a parasitic infection caused by nematodes (roundworms) of the genus Trichinella. Pigs and wild game are important sources of human infection [ 1 ]; a number of other animals are also epidemiologically important hosts [ 2 ]. Consumption of raw or undercooked meat is the principal mode of transmission.

WebTrichinosis, or trichinellosis, is one of the most widespread global parasitic diseases of humans and animals. This ancient disease is caused by the larval stage of parasitic roundworms (nematodes) in the genus Trichinella.
